Definition and Structure
A Sankey chart was first introduced by William Henry Sankey, a British railway engineer, in 1898. It consists of a series of interconnected links, or “sankeys,” that show the flow quantity of a resource or value between different sources and sinks. The width and direction of the lines indicate the magnitude and direction of the flow, making it visually clear how data moves through a system or processes.
Creating a Sankey Chart
Creating a Sankey chart is relatively straightforward and can be done using various data visualization software like Excel, Tableau, or online tools like Plotly, D3.js, and Google Charts. Here’s a basic process to create one:
- Data Preparation: Start by organizing your data in a tabular format, with columns representing the sources (locations where data starts), destinations (locations where data ends), and the flow quantity between them.
- Select the Chart Type: Choose the Sankey chart format in your preferred software or tool.
- Visualize: Input your data and the chart will automatically create the flow diagram with links connecting source to destination, with the width proportional to the flow quantity.
- Adjust Configurations: Customize your chart by adding labels, colors, or gradients to make it more readable and visually appealing.
Applications
Sankey charts find immense value in a variety of contexts where understanding the flow of information, resources, or processes is critical:
- Supply Chain Analysis: In logistics and manufacturing, they help visualize inventory movement, shipping, and distribution, highlighting bottlenecks and areas for optimization.
- Energy Efficiency: Energy flow through power grids or energy production systems can be visualized with Sankey charts, aiding in understanding and improving the efficiency of the infrastructure.
- Financial Visualization: Banks and investment firms use Sankey charts to present financial transactions, showing money flows between different accounts or portfolios.
- Environmental Impact: By tracking the lifecycle of products, Sankey charts can depict environmental footprints and illustrate the interconnectivity of industries.
- Policy Analysis: Policymakers use Sankey charts to illustrate the impact of policies on various sectors or regions, making informed decisions based on cause-and-effect relationships.
Visual Insights and Interpretation
The visual nature of Sankey charts allows users to discern patterns, trends, and inefficiencies at a glance. The direction and width of the links provide immediate information about the direction and magnitude of the flow, making it easier to recognize data flow patterns, sinks, and potential bottlenecks.
Comparing Sankey charts across time or comparing different processes enables users to identify changes and monitor progress. By providing a comprehensive view of the connections and dependencies between elements, these charts help stakeholders make informed decisions and create more effective strategies.
